从低碳到碳中和:现状、演变和发展趋势的文献计量分析。

From low carbon to carbon neutrality: A bibliometric analysis of the status, evolution and development trend.

Abstract

With global climate change becoming increasingly serious, carbon neutrality, a key strategy to mitigate climate change, has attracted widespread attention. However, due to the multidisciplinary and complexity of carbon neutrality studies, as well as the diversification of research content, a comprehensive review and systematic synthesis of which is quite limited. In this paper, a bibliometric analysis on the topic of carbon neutrality is conducted to reveal the research progress from a quantitative and visual perspective and describe the evolution of research hotspots. The results show that carbon neutrality research is abundant at both the macro and micro levels. Low carbon development is the premise of carbon neutrality, and emission reduction and carbon sinks are the basis of carbon neutrality. The degree of research varies significantly in different countries, with China dominating in the number of publications, followed by the USA and the UK. The realization of carbon neutrality cannot be fully achieved by one single perspective and requires a comprehensive and systematic analysis of technology, economy, and society. Carbon neutrality is a technology-driven process guided by policy. Economically, carbon taxes and carbon markets are two important market mechanisms for reducing carbon emissions. Technically, researches of negative carbon technologies and renewable energy are growing rapidly. Carbon market, carbon negative technology, circular economy, and green energy will become the focus of future research. This paper helps scholars to understand the overall state of carbon neutrality research and provides a historical reference for future research.

摘要

随着全球气候变化日益严重,碳中性作为一种缓解气候变化的关键策略,已经引起了广泛关注。然而,由于碳中性研究的跨学科性和复杂性,以及研究内容的多样化,对其进行全面的回顾和系统的综合分析是相当有限的。本文对碳中性这一主题进行了文献计量分析,从定量和可视化的角度揭示了研究进展,并描述了研究热点的演变。结果表明,碳中性研究在宏观和微观层面都很丰富。低碳发展是碳中性的前提,减排和碳汇是碳中性的基础。不同国家的研究程度差异显著,中国在出版物数量上占据主导地位,其次是美国和英国。碳中性的实现不能仅从单一视角出发,需要对技术、经济和社会进行全面和系统的分析。碳中性是一个由政策指导的技术驱动过程。在经济方面,碳税和碳市场是减少碳排放的两个重要市场机制。在技术方面,负碳技术和可再生能源的研究正在迅速发展。碳市场、碳负技术、循环经济和绿色能源将成为未来研究的重点。本文有助于学者了解碳中性研究的整体状况,并为未来的研究提供历史参考。
